Chamber of Commerce San Luis Obispo
Chamber of Commerce San Luis Obispo is a Chambers of Commerce company at San Luis Obispo,California,United States , Tel is (805)781-2777,address is 1039 Chorro Street.You can find more Chamber of Commerce San Luis Obispo contact info like fax,email,website below.